Run-and-drive does not guarantee easy loading
An auction description is not a complete recovery assessment. A vehicle may start yet still have a flat battery, low tyre, locked brake, damaged suspension or missing key. Conversely, many non-runners can be transported safely when their wheels, steering and loading access are understood before dispatch.
Damaged and salvage vehicle transport
Send wide photographs of the complete vehicle and close-ups of damaged wheels, steering, suspension, bodywork and ground clearance. Tell us if panels are loose, airbags have deployed, fluids are leaking or parts sit close to the ground. Undisclosed damage can make the assigned transporter unsuitable.

What reference should I send?
Send the lot, stock, order or release reference used by the seller, together with the buyer or member details required for collection.
Can you collect a vehicle with a flat battery?
Often yes. Tell us in advance. Where safe and suitable, battery assistance may help confirm whether the vehicle can run for loading.
Can you collect without keys?
It may require different equipment and seller permission. Confirm the wheel and steering condition and send photographs before accepting a quote.
